Membrane Labs and BitGo are pleased to announce a strategic partnership aimed at enhancing BitGo’s prime services offerings. This collaboration will leverage Membrane’s advanced digital asset management technology infrastructure to drive BitGo’s financing business, including capabilities in lending, borrowing, and potentially margin trading.
“We are thrilled to integrate Membrane’s technology into our financing operations,” said Mike Belshe, CEO at BitGo. “This partnership enables us to expand our financing solutions, optimizes our operations, and positions us to offer more advanced capital solutions in the future.”

Membrane’s loan management software, which facilitated over $3 billion in bookings last year, is designed to streamline prime services. By incorporating this technology, BitGo aims to deliver comprehensive financing solutions that maximize capital efficiency for their clients.
“Our technology has been developed over the past four years with a focus on enabling prime services,” said Carson Cook, CEO of Membrane Labs. “We’re excited to see it deployed by a digital asset leader like BitGo and look forward to supporting their continued success as they expand their product lines.”

About Membrane Labs
Membrane Labs delivers institutional-grade solutions for managing digital assets, minimizing operational and counterparty risk while maximizing operational and capital efficiency. Accessible via API or web interface, the Membrane platform offers fully customizable workflows for loan lifecycle management, post-trade OTC management and settlement across trading and derivatives, and streamlined treasury operations, including reconciliation, payments, and real-time reporting.
